This is (also) something that has been bugging me for a while. There is a prominent focus on a show's creator in the TV database but you will not find any clear definition of that role (aka wiki). What for me is even worse however is that it's not something that every show has or cares about.

Just going by Wikipedia you will already get multiple possible "creator" roles https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Television_program_creators... In the DB I saw all kinds of usage of the field; be it the showrunner (which can change), the author of the first/couple episodes, the author of the source material or even the production company. What is it now and should the field really be this "exclusive" for TV?

I think the creator is just the person who is specifically credited that way -- "Created by XXX" or "Developed by XXX", or list that on the official website. It's true that not all shows have that, and in that case I leave it empty. Showrunners don't count as creators, as they change indeed. They are just the main producer/writer, if I understand correctly.

I think I also saw the "created by" in one of two movies, but I think that isn't really a thing for movies.

But if it has to be an explicit credit then the potential "targets" for this will be even fewer. I don't have a problem with the credit existing but more of how prominent it is in the DB... just leads to more "wrong" uses (by whatever definition).

@alltimemarr is right, it's just about who created it. If a show doesn't have a creator that it cares about, it's ok to leave it empty. This reply doesn't make it more clear to me given the "first episode" note... @alltimemarr & @travisbell suggested that it should be an explicit credit which would be easy to make out... Going by "involvement" is a lot more difficult. In case of anime for example (with not as much "original" programming) most would attribute it to the main director of a show but he usually isn't alone in this as there is also someone doing series composition (which usually gets attributed to the creator role in addition to just writing) as well as individual episode directors, storyboarders and script writers as in other media. In addition to that there is a lot of reliance on visuals which is often also driven by the studio entities and makes them recognizable or the talent they have working. Something like for example "Gurren Lagann would not exist or play out like it does if it was made by a different Studio than Gainax.
